
Zoe Gillis
MCP, RCC
Zoe is a Registered Clinical Counsellor with the British Columbia Association of Clinical Counsellors (BCACC)
What it's like to work with Zoe
Struggles arise in life that can leave us feeling defeated, confused, alone, or lost. As a counsellor, I bring a warm, curious, and empathic approach to support you in gaining a deeper understanding of yourself and work through challenging experiences, emotions, and internal conflicts that are holding you back. I will help you discover tools and ways to tap into your inner strengths so you can step into a more confident, empowered, and self-compassionate you.
My work is primarily with teens and adults experiencing challenges related to anxiety, grief and loss, life transitions, relationship difficulties, stress, and self-esteem. I integrate a variety of modalities including person-centered, cognitive behaviour, dialectical behavioural, psychodynamic, strength-based, and emotion-focused therapies.
I completed a Bachelor’s degree in psychology from the University of British Columbia and a Masters of Counselling Psychology from Yorkville University. My background includes supporting youth and adults in community settings and post-secondary education. I also have a background in professional sports and extensive experience with coaching at all levels including youth development, collegiate-levels, and internationally.
I bring forward my passion for working with people and fostering environments for creating meaningful and long-lasting change into my work as a counsellor. My goal is to provide a safe space where you are seen, heard, respected, and collaborated with to ensure you have the support suitable to your unique needs and experiences.
